This marble statue by sculptor Jilma Madera has watched over the city of Havana since its 1958 inauguration. The monument has one of the most beautiful vistas of Havana due to its placement on one of the city’s highest points. Go at sunset—it’s romantic then. Some visitors take a marble stone as a token of good luck.

The statue was carved out of white Carrara marble, the same material used for many of the monuments of the Colon Cemetery. The statue is about 20 metres (66 ft) high including a 3-metre (10 ft) base. It weighs approximately 320 tons. The statue was built from 67 blocks of marble that had been brought from Italy after being personally blessed by Pope Pius XII. The figure of Christ is standing with the right hand held near the chin and the left hand near his chest. Facing the city, the statue was left with empty eyes to give the impression of looking at all, from anywhere to be seen. The sculpture, located in the Havana suburb of Casablanca, in the municipality of Regla, was inaugurated on La Cabaña hill on December 24, 1958. Just fifteen days after its inauguration, on January 8, 1959, Fidel Castro entered Havana during the Cuban Revolution. The sculpture is located 51 meters (167 ft) above sea level, rising to a height of 79 metres (259 ft), allowing the locals to see it from many points of the city. There is a panoramic viewpoint at the site of the sculpture.

The Christ of Havana (Spanish: Cristo de La Habana) is a large sculpture representing Jesus of Nazareth on a hilltop overlooking the bay in Havana, Cuba. It is the work of the Cuban sculptor Jilma Madera, who won the commission for it in 1953. The statue was carved out of white Carrara marble, the same material used for many of the monuments of the Colon Cemetery. The statue is about 20 metres (66 ft) high including a 3-metre (10 ft) base.[1] It weighs approximately 320 tons. The statue was built from 67 blocks of marble that had been brought from Italy after being personally blessed by Pope Pius XII.

This marble 20 meters tall Christ statue is located in the opposite shore of the Bay, welcoming visitors that arrive by the port. It was carved by the famous Cuban artist Jilma Madera. From that advantage point you can have one of the most beautiful views of Havana. The fishermen village below the hill where it is located is very folkloric. Also, near the mirador there is located a small museum related with Che Guevara.
